海洋水文工作者在日常工作中,经常需要绘制线路图来展示海洋环境的变化趋势和相关数据。而Matlab作为一种强大的计算和绘图工具,被广泛应用于海洋科学领域,尤其是在水文调查和数据分析方面。掌握通过Matlab实现线路图绘制,对于海洋水文工作者来说,是必不可少的技能之一。: |6 `9 \, p$ q; X5 a1 L
% M. q" _9 i4 F首先,通过Matlab绘制线路图可以方便地展示海洋水文数据的时间序列变化。例如,我们可以使用Matlab读取并处理海洋观测站的温度、盐度、流速等数据,然后利用绘图函数将这些数据以线路图的形式呈现出来。线路图能够清晰地显示数据的波动和趋势,帮助研究人员更好地理解海洋环境的变化规律。
9 i# V4 o, E. g+ j: f. j$ P: G8 a9 v! R0 A- a5 i
其次,Matlab提供了丰富的绘图函数和工具箱,可以实现各种定制化的线路图绘制需求。无论是绘制简单的折线图,还是绘制复杂的多曲线图,Matlab都能够满足水文工作者的需求。通过设置不同的线型、颜色和标记,可以区分不同的数据系列;通过调整坐标轴范围和刻度,可以凸显数据特征;通过添加标题、标签和图例,可以使线路图更具可读性和可视化效果。 ^# _6 Z7 i& w& S" g
" @# M$ ^+ m( H" B2 c$ M9 B# @2 K
此外,Matlab还支持在线路图中添加附加信息和分析结果。例如,水文工作者可以通过Matlab计算某个时间段内的平均值、最大值、最小值等统计量,并将这些结果以文字或者图形的形式嵌入到线路图中。这样一来,线路图不仅仅是一个展示数据的工具,同时也成为了一个帮助分析和解释数据的工具,提高了数据处理和理解的效率。1 ?* t$ H7 V/ ` T9 F
: b# V: g5 }! f
除了绘制时间序列线路图,Matlab还可以用于绘制空间分布的线路图。例如,在海洋水文调查中,我们经常需要绘制流速等参数在海域中的分布图。利用Matlab的地图工具箱和绘图函数,我们可以将观测站的数据以线路图的形式叠加在海图上,清晰地展示海洋水文参数在空间上的变化特征。这种线路图不仅能够反映海域内不同位置的差异,还能够揭示海流的变化趋势和演化规律,对于研究海洋环境和海洋动力学起到重要的作用。% q \* [) ~3 n6 I
: {0 p9 l; J$ ?0 a( Q
综上所述,通过Matlab实现线路图绘制是海洋水文工作者必备的技能之一。掌握这一技能可以帮助工作者更好地展示和分析海洋水文数据,提高工作效率和科研水平。然而,仅仅掌握绘图函数和工具还不够,水文工作者还需要具备对数据的深入理解和分析能力,才能真正将线路图绘制应用于科学研究和实际工作中,为海洋科学的发展做出贡献。 |